> I'm running Woody.  Soon after I installed Debian, I installed PHP4
> with MySQL support but not with PostgreSQL.  Now I want to include
> support for PostgreSQL, but I'm not sure how to recompile PHP to
> include it ... when it was done automatically for me when installed
> via apt-get.  Thanks!

Don't think you have to 'recompile' anything.  I assune that you mean
that you installed php4-mysql and now want to also (?) install the
PostgreSQL modules.

apt-cache search php |grep pgsql yields
php3-cgi-pgsql - PostgreSQL module for PHP3 (use with php3-cgi)
php3-pgsql - PostgreSQL module for PHP3 (use with php3)
php4-pgsql - PostgreSQL module for php4

So I would load php4-pgsql and make the proper changes in 
/etc/php4/apache/php.ini to select the required module.

NOTE:  I have not used postgresql and don't know if you can enable
both mysql and postgresql in the php.ini file at the same time.  It
seems likely you can but...?
